RemixesHere are entered recorded musical works derived from one or more existing sound recordings through processes known as remixing. This heading is applied to sound recordings that are entirely remixes, prominently identified as remix(es), mixes, or expressions such as dance mix and club mix, but not to recordings where mix(es) means only medley, mixture, or miscellaneous.
